En ligne site de casino, 888.com a parrainé la Premier League Darts Event 2005 dernier et maintenant ils sont de retour. 888.com est à nouveau parrain de cet événement qui est actuellement détenu au Royaume-Uni et le coup d’envoi à Londres, l’événement sera piste pendant 15 semaines consécutives tenue de l’événement une fois par semaine jusqu’au 19 mai de cette année. Barry Hearn, le président de la Société au Royaume-Uni Professional Darts est ravi d’avoir 888.com en tant que parrain de base pour Premier League Darts, qui est considéré comme le plus grand événement sportif à l’intérieur dans le pays depuis des années. Hearn continue qu’il s’attend à un grand nombre de fans pour remplir les 15 arènes réservé pour l’événement, la promotion de casinos en ligne dans le pays ainsi.
888.com, un site de casino en ligne à l’origine soutenir les événements, a été remplacé par Holsten et White & MacKay depuis un certain temps, mais est maintenant de retour pour de futures innovations, le développement et la promotion du marché des casinos en ligne. Adi Soffer, le directeur général de 888.com a noté que ce grand événement est un moyen fantastique pour l’entreprise de rétablir et de faire de nouveaux nœuds avec d’autres marques existantes dans le marché des jeux. Il a en outre continué que c’est un honneur d’être une fois de plus le seul commanditaire de l’événement fléchettes Premier League, qui est maintenant devenu mondial et est très populaire en s’attendant à obtenir 80.000 aficionados fléchette sur ledit événement.

Libertarians usually favor special state protection for
children, allowing the state to interfere with parents who
endanger, neglect, or harm children. This can include
providing children with a “safety net” of basic healthcare and
social services. A system favoring special benefits based on
redistribution of wealth for competent adults, however, is
considered unjust. Hence, a system like that in the United
States that provides many social and health benefits to
competent and even wealthy adults but not to children, for
example, in the allocation of healthcare benefits, goods, and
services, would be viewed by libertarians as unjust.

the procedures used for distribution. The best-known defender
of this position is John Rawls, who in A Theory of
Justice (1971) and Political Liberalism (1993) contends that
people form stable and just societies by building a consensus
that merits endorsement by rational and informed people of
goodwill.
This entails a commitment to three principles of justice.
First, “each person is to have an equal right to the most
extensive system of equal basic liberties compatible with a
similar system compatible for all.” Second, “offices and
positions are to be open to all under conditions of equality of
fair opportunity–persons with similar abilities and skills are
to have equal access to offices and positions.” Finally, “social
and economic institutions are to be arranged so as to benefit
maximally the worst off” (Rawls, 1971, p. 60). These
principles are ordered lexically such that the first, the greatest
equal-liberty principle, takes precedence over the others
when they conflict and the second, the principle of fair
equality of opportunity, takes precedence over the third, the
difference principle. Nowhere is healthcare as a right mentioned
specifically in Rawls’s attempt to frame the basic
structure of a just society. This is understandable because a
society may not have enough healthcare goods, services, or
benefits to distribute. In a society that does have such goods,
services, and benefits, however, their fair distribution seems
central to promoting fair equality of opportunity and benefits
to the worst off.
